Spanish energy industry association Club Espanol de la Energia (CEE) has recognised renewables publication reNEWS with a prestigious award for news coverage of the green energy sector.
The subscriber-only publication and online news service was awarded the gong in the category ‘Energy: Innovation’.
The accolade is in “recognition of the work of dissemination and better knowledge carried out on energy issues”, according to CEE.
President Miguel Antoñanzas Alvear (pictured, right) and Siemens Gamesa marketing director Juan Diego Diaz Vega (left) presented the award to reNEWS Spain correspondent Lisa Louis at a ceremony in Madrid on Monday.
Speaking at the event, the 29th CEE awards, Alvear said the media’s role in the fight against climate change is fundamental.
“We need the coverage, as despite the Paris climate agreement CO2 emissions have gone up over the past two years,” he said in front of about 100 business leaders and politicians.
Other winners at the event include Juan Cruz Pena from daily El Confidencial in the category “Petrol”, José María Camarero from news agency Colpisa in the area “Electricity”.
